Research Shows Chiropractic Care Helps Prevent Chronic Issues After an Auto Accident

The science confirms what we see in our office: A British study was conducted on 28 people diagnosed with chronic whiplash syndrome. Each participant received chiropractic adjustments and 93% of them experienced improvements following their adjustments, even though 43 percent of whiplash sufferers overall usually never find relief. This confirms that chiropractic adjustments is a great way to avoid long-term pain after a crash.
